Struck by swinging part of powered vehicle · Fractures

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at Martin Marietta Aggregates, 9519 Galveston Rd., HOUSTON, TEXAS 77034 on , Fractures, affecting the wrist(s).

An employee was scraping loose paint on a railcar door. The employee's hand was caught in the door when it closed unexpectedly. The employee sustained a fractured right wrist.
